Initial data
On February 3, 1995, two soldiers of the Russian army, privates Shepin and Zhabanov, were on guard at a military base of fuel and lubricants near the town of Gusev, not far from the Polish border. Both soldiers claim that for several minutes there was an unknown object shining with a bright greenish-blue light over the territory of the base at a low altitude. This is how Private Zhabanov described this case in his report:
"On February 3, 1995, from 22.00 to 24.00, I was part of the guard at post No. 2, located in the southeastern part of the base. At about 24.00, I descended from the observation tower and, making a detour of my territory, headed towards the zone guarded by sentries from post No. 1. After walking about fifteen meters, I saw a glowing greenish object above me, at a height of about twenty meters.
At first it seemed to me that the object looked like a large signal rocket. However, he flew horizontally, along the base fence, and behind him stretched a bright fiery tail, like a comet. At some point in time, a smaller part of the object separated from the object, which began to fall down. The remaining part continued to move away, its glow became less bright, it seemed to shrink in size and soon disappeared from sight."
